Tweeners 4, Bees 0
Tweeners sweep 4 game April homestand vs. Bees by scores of 2-1, 9-8, 9-3, and 6-1. Starters earning wins were Anderson, Ray, Montgomery, and Snell. Losses were charged to Nelson, Sabathia, Wacha, and Verlander. Petit picked up a couple of saves. Offensive star for he Bees was former Tweener Avisail Garcia, who hit .375 and drove in 8 runs, but as a team the Bees hit only .217 with an ERA of 7.31. A nice team effort from the Tweeners, hitting .313 with a 3.25 ERA.

Buckeyes 8, Fungoes 2
Fungoes got schooled by the Buckeyes today, all games played on pc. Buckeyes win 8 of 10.
Hanley Ramirez hit 4 HRs and drove in 16 for the Bucks in the 10 game series.
May 15 at WTF:
Buckeyes win it in 10 innings 5-4.
May 16 at WTF:
Buckeyes score in the 9th to win it 3-2.
June 27 at Buckeyes:
Buckeyes hit a Grand Slam in the 1st and don't look back winning it 7-2.
June 28 at Buckeyes:
Buckeyes explode winning it 13-3! Shitfuck!!
June 29 at Buckeyes:
Kershaw isn't enough for the Fungoes as the Bucks win it 6-5.
July 23 at WTF:
Bucks win another close one 4-3.
July 24 at WTF:
Fungoes finally break loose and win one 2-1.
July 25 at WTF:
Read above final score 2-1.
September 3 at Bucks:
Buckeyes win it 4-3.
September 4 at Bucks:
Another 1 run loss for the Fungoes as the Bucks finish off the series, winning this one 5-4.
8 of the 10 games were 1 run decisions but really the way the Buckeyes were mashing HRs it seemed
like every game was a 10 run loss!!

Fungoes 9, Mavs 1
Fungoes vs Mavs
May 13 at WTF: Fungoes win this one 3-0 behind a strong outing by
David Price. Will Harris gets the save
and Odorizzi takes the loss for the Mavman.
Sal Perez hits his 4th dinger of the season for the Fungoes.
May 14 at WTF: Fungoes score early and run up a 6-1 lead through 4
innings. Fungoes win it 7-2 behind a
strong Dan Straily performance. Hammel
takes the loss. Harper homers for the
Mavs while Betts cranks one for the Fungoes.
June 24 at Mavland: Fungoes streak out to a 7-0 lead and take a 7-3 lead
into the bottom of the ninth. However,
at just that moment, The Mav bats awaken and tally 6 runs to walk it off 9-7 on
a 2-out GRAND SLAM HOMERUN off the bat of Tommy Joseph. Robles picked up the win in relief while Will
Harris SUFFERED the loss!!
June 25 at Mavland: This time it is the Mavs with a big lead early 5-2
until the Fungoes score 2 in the 7th and 2 more in the 8th
and hold on to win it 6-5. Santiago
improves to 3-0 while Harris picks up his 9th save. Rodriguez takes the loss in relief for the
Mavs. Murphy, Odor, McCann, Harper and
Gyorko all homer.
June 26 at Mavland: Fungoes score 4 in the first but the Mavs tie it up
4-4 with a 2 spot in the fourth inning.
Fungoes score 2 in the 6th and 2 more in the 7th
and hold on to win it 9-5. Lance
McCullers evens his record at 2-2 while Hellickson takes the loss. Harris gets the save. Homerun derby continues with Murphy smashing
2 while Betts, Hosmer, Harper and Davis all hit 1 each.
July 20 at WTF: Mavs take a rare lead in the top of the second scoring
1 run. Fungoes tie it up in the fourth
and walk it off with a 2 run Francisco Lindor homerun! Strickland takes the loss in relief while
Robertson picks up the win for the Fungoes,
July 21 at WTF: All Fungoes as they win it 7-0. Lance McCullers improves to 3-2 and combines
with Carlos Torres for the shutout.
Hammel takes the loss for the Mavs.
July 22 at WTF: Another Fungo shutout as Kershaw weaves magic and
improves to 7-1 on the season. O’Day
finishes up the last 2 innings for the combined shutout for the Fungoes. Hellickson takes the loss. Fungoes win 6-0.
September 01 at Mavland: Fungoes score in 6 different innings and win it
6-3. David Price
gets the win and improves to 4-3 on the season.
Hammel takes the loss and Will Harris notches save number 11. Odor, Sal Perez, McCann, Harper and Gyorko
all homer.
September 02 at Mavland: Mike Trout homered and had 2 RBI as the red-hot
Waxahachie Fungoes defeated the floundering Midlothian Mavs in 11 innings by the
score of 5 to 2 at Juan Gonzalez Field. The score was knotted at 2 after nine innings. Finally, Waxahachie pulled the game out in the 11th inning. Carlos Beltran led off and started the attack as he drew a walk.
Two outs later Francisco Lindor came to bat and laced a single. Matt
Carpenter then doubled scoring two baserunners.
Trout came up and he laced a base-hit scoring the final run of the
inning. Waxahachie finished with 13 hits while Midlothian ended up with
8.
The win went to Carlos Torres (2-2) who allowed no
runs in 2 innings. Torres
was helped out by Will Harris who recorded his 12th
save. Hansel Robles
took the loss in relief.
